An upper-wedge-type electronic wedge brake (EWB) with a new structure (moving upper wedge) was proposed. The EWB consists of a bearing grip stick (BGS), a single motor, roller, and upper wedge. Dynamic modelling of the motor, reduction gear, screw, BGS, and wedge was performed, and a braking performance simulator for the EWB and EWB-equipped vehicle was developed. The braking performance of the proposed EWB was verified via the test bench and dynamometer test. The results of the simulation and test showed that the EWB proposed in this study had the required braking performance without jamming the wedge. Despite the change in the friction coefficient, the EWB yielded a performance that depended on the target clamping force by push-pull control of the upper wedge through a motor. The results of this study can be used as a basis for the design and control of upper-wedge-type EWBs.
